I just got hired as a new grad for HCGH on 4 south! I moved from out of state so I was not too familiar with the area. Columbia was too expensive (but would have been convenient since my boyfriend and I both work there). We tried Ellicott city which was close but some areas were a little sketchy. We ended up in Owings MIlls (30 minutes away) but its cheaper. We plan on trying to move to Columbia next year. Congrats on the job-maybe I will see you in the hospital.

I live in Catonsville- which if you ask me is just as nice as Columbia/Ellicott City and a whole heck of a lot cheaper. Howard County for the most part is expensive. I used to live in both EC and Columbia...Columbia I didn't like ( too crowded) and I liked Ellicott City but rent started to get WAYYY too expensive. I own my home...but I know rent by me for a 2 BR is about $900 a month.
